 Thanks are due to the following individuals:

  - T.C. Zhao and Mark Overmars for creating the XForms Library
    GUI. It's ease of use helped concentrating more on the
    program parts doing the work rather those dealing with the
    appearance of the user interface. Great work guys!

  - Luca Maranzano <liuk@kirk.linux.it> for maintaining the
    Debian Linux binary distributions of xisp up until version 2.4.

  - I.Ioannou <roryt@hol.gr> for providing an alternative FTP site
    for the xisp distribution, for his very helpful feedback and
    suggestions on improving xisp, and for extensive beta testing.

  - Peter T. Breuer <ptb@it.uc3m.es> for his help in extensively
    testing xisp on a *very* loaded system and his contribution
    to the alternative pppd-PID search code.

  - Raphael Wegmann <wegmann@ophelia.tuwien.ac.at> for providing
    the animated XPM icons and code that runs the animation, as
    well as contributing code for the ip-up/ip-down support.

  - Doron Shikmoni <P85025@VM.BIU.AC.IL> for suggesting and then
    spending quite a bit of time testing the call-back feature,
    as well as his ideas on improving the scripting capabilities
    of xisp.

  - Ximenes Zalteca <ximenes@netset.com> for supporting the RPM
    source and binary packaging of xisp up to and including version
    2.3p7, for use with the Red Hat Linux distribution (Ximenes has
    since stopped maintaining RPM releases of xisp, so please
    refrain from contacting him on this subject).

  - Dave Holland <dave@zenda.demon.co.uk> for his extensive beta
    testing of the I/O-driven call-back code, and his contribution
    of perl code for parsing the ipparam string.

  - Tillmann Steinbrecher <tst@gmx.de> for letting me use the code
    he developed for the pppcosts program, as well as the phone
    company information included therein.

  - Fabrice Bellet <Fabrice.Bellet@imag.fr> for his extensive
    modifications of the cost calculation code to cover the case
    of non-linear minimum charge times (in per-minute PTT charging
    schemes), as well as his invaluable help (feedback and patches)
    while beta-testing the PTT editor and its associated cost
    calculation engine.

  - Martin Bialasinski <Martin.Bialasinski@uni-koeln.de> for
    maintaining the Debian Linux binary distributions of xisp from
    version 2.5 and on.
